- [ ] Step 7: Archive cold storage buckets (Glacierline tier). Confirm both ceremony witnesses are present, verify bucket manifests match the Oxbow ledger, then seal the archive key shares. Plugin authors may observe but not handle shares. Once sealed, the archive index itself is encrypted and can only be reopened with the passphrase below.

vault phrase of badup-hahig = tamael-aldael-kelmir-istael-fenok-istwyn-tamius-jorath-oliion

## Onboarding: Calendar Sync Conflicts

Hey reviewer — quick context before you dig into the Tindlemark sync branch. When two devices edit the same event offline, our merge step picks the later `revised_at` and stashes the loser in `event_conflicts` for manual review. The bug we're fixing is that all-day events get a midnight timestamp, so they basically always lose. Tests cover the tie-break path now. To run the integration suite locally you'll need the conflicts database, which you can reach with the connection string below.

primary connection of tadup-tagep = mongodb://fendor_svc:6hZCOAA@db-14a7.plorvaworks.test:5432/giliel

## Deployment

The Cartwheel scanner bridge talks to the handheld barcode units over the warehouse LAN, so deploy it on the box nearest the dock switch — latency matters more than CPU here. Restart the bridge after any firmware update on the scanners, or pairing gets weird. Once it's up, make sure the config matches the following.

config for kajog-tadug:
[casax]
port = 11211
region = west-3
host = casax.nelvroworks.internal
timeout_ms = 5000
retries = 7

TURN-208: Gatevale turnstile counters at the Merrow Field pilot double-count when a rotation reverses mid-cycle. Attendance totals drift roughly 2% high per event. The debounce window fix is implemented, reviewed by Ilsa, and soak-tested across two simulated match days without drift. Ready for your cut; the candidate build is identified below.

trace token, tagag-tafog: htk6_5ed18c